The National Frontier Trails Museum in Independence, Missouri, is a captivating destination for tourists seeking to dive deep into the history of westward expansion in America. Here, you can explore fascinating exhibits and artifacts that tell the story of pioneers who courageously ventured into the unknown, making it a must-visit for history enthusiasts and families alike.
